More About The Team
The BOI UK plc Financial Control team is responsible for the controlling and reporting on BOI UK plc's financial position and performance. The team prepares the statutory accounts and regulatory returns associated with a plc and regulated entity. The team also provides information to internal partners to support business decision making.
Financial Control work closely with partners across the Group and third parties to ensure that there is a continued focus on delivering a culture of service excellence, developing our people and supporting the achievement of the Group's strategic priorities. Financial Control takes lead responsibility in ensuring that the control environment around accounting processes is robust and that reporting delivery is timely and to high standards of accuracy.
